Filter Your Search

Off-Campus Furnished Apartments for Rent in Allston

5 Rentals Available

    • Chroma - Chroma

    Chroma

    3 BedsCall for Price

    240 Sidney St, Cambridge, MA 02139

    ★★★★★
    ★★★★★
    1.6 miles to Simmons